USA and Belgium Advance to Round of 16 in World Cup

In the 2026 FIFA World Cup, the USA National Team secured a place in the Round of 16 by defeating Bosnia and Herzegovina 2-0. The match featured a disciplined performance from the USA, with striker Folarin Balogun scoring the opening goal before being sent off in the second half.
Despite playing with ten men, the USA maintained composure, and Malik Tillman sealed the victory with a free kick in the 82nd minute. Meanwhile, Belgium achieved a remarkable comeback against Senegal, overcoming a two-goal deficit to win 3-2 after extra time.
Veteran striker Romelu Lukaku played a crucial role in Belgium's resurgence, scoring late in normal time, and Youri Tielemans converted a penalty in stoppage time to complete the comeback. This sets up an enticing Round of 16 clash between the USA and Belgium, with the USA seeking to avenge their elimination by Belgium in the 2014 World Cup.
